‘NCIS’ executive producer Gary Glasberg dies in Los Angeles at 50

The executive producer of TV’s “NCIS” and creator of “NCIS: New Orleans” has died. CBS says in a statement that Gary Glasberg died in his sleep Wednesday. He was 50. Glasberg joined “NCIS” as a producer and writer in 2009 and became its showrunner in 2011. He launched the New Orleans version of the show in 2014.

He had signed a new three-year overall deal with “NCIS” producers CBS Television Studios that would have kept him at the helm of both shows through 2019. Glasberg’s other television credits include “Shark,” “The Mentalist,” “Crossing Jordan” and “Bones.” He is survived by his wife, Mimi Schmir, and two sons.
